General Description
Perfluorocyclohexyl carboxylic acid fluoride is a chemical compound that belongs to the perfluorocarboxylic acid family and is used in various industrial applications. It is known for its high thermal stability, chemical resistance, and low surface tension properties. PERFLUOROCYCLOHEXYL CARBOXYLIC ACID FLUORIDE is commonly used as a surfactant, lubricant, and in the production of fluoropolymers. It is also used in the electronics industry for its ability to repel water and oil, making it ideal for use in coatings and electronic components. However, there are growing concerns about its environmental impact and potential health risks, leading to increased regulations and restrictions on its use.
Check Digit Verification of cas no
The CAS Registry Mumber 6588-63-2 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 6,5,8 and 8 respectively; the second part has 2 digits, 6 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 6588-63:
(6*6)+(5*5)+(4*8)+(3*8)+(2*6)+(1*3)=132
132 % 10 = 2
So 6588-63-2 is a valid CAS Registry Number.
